Executive Summary & Key Takeaways

**Executive Summary** This circular from the Directorate General of Shipping, Mumbai, dated July 30, 2024, announces a revision of one-time registration fees and annual fees for services related to ISPS and the DG Communication Centre. The fee revision is effective from August 1, 2024, and aims to cover the increasing operational expenses of the Communication Centre. **Key Points / Main Content** * **Fee Revision:** * The one-time registration fees and annual fees for the DG Communication Centre are revised. * The proposed fee structure was circulated among stakeholders, and their feedback was considered. * The revised fees are due after August 1, 2024. * **Revised Fee Structure (One-Time Registration Fees/Annual Recurring Fees):** * Major Ports: Rs. 2,00,000/- / Rs. 1,50,000/- * Non-major Ports (Quay Length > 1000 mtrs): Rs. 2,00,000/- / Rs. 1,50,000/- * Non-major Ports (Quay Length 500-1000 mtrs): Rs. 1,50,000/- / Rs. 1,00,000/- * Non-major Ports (Quay Length < 500 mtrs): Rs. 60,000/- / Rs. 50,000/- * Shipyards: Rs. 60,000/- / Rs. 50,000/- * Ships (Worldwide): Rs. 24,000/- / Rs. 20,000/- * Ships (Coastal): Rs. 12,000/- / Rs. 8,000/- * **Payment Details:** * Payments should be made by crossed cheque in favour of "Indian Register of Shipping". * Payments can be delivered/mailed or made via NEFT/RTGS to the provided bank account. * Receipts will be issued directly by IRS. * **Other Provisions:** * Fee demand will be raised to the ports and shipyards by DG Communication Centre of DG Shipping. * Auditors verifying major, non-major ports, and Indian ships should verify dues. * Port authorities and ship owners must pay fees before ISPS audits. * Penalties will be imposed for late fee payments. * Fees are checked during annual Ship Security Alert System (SSAS) testing. * Fund collected is for the operation of DG Comm Centre and based on cost-sharing. **Impact Analysis** **Stakeholder: Major Ports, Non-Major Ports, Shipyards, Ship Owners (Worldwide and Coastal)** * **Impact:** The revised fee structure will increase the costs associated with ISPS and DG Communication Centre services. * **Action Required:** Update their budgets and payment procedures to reflect the new fees, ensuring timely payments to avoid penalties. **Stakeholder: Auditors Undertaking Verification Audits** * **Impact:** Auditors are now required to verify that dues are paid to the DGCOMM Centre. * **Action Required:** Include verification of DGCOMM Centre dues as part of their audit procedures.

Branch Circular No: NTiISPSiO2i2olO, dated, 22nd, January 2010, which communicated the requirements regarding the fee payable for the operation and maintenance of the DG Communication Centre to all ship owners and port flacilities. 2. Over the past decade, the maritime industry has experienced significant growth, leading to an increase in both the number of Indian seafarers and ship raffic in Indian waters. Consequently, the role of the DG Communication Centre has expanded considerably, necessitating greater efforts to manage its role and responsibilities. 3. In light of the increasing number of security and casualty incidents in the Red Sea, Gulf of Aden, and surrounding regions. the DGCommunication Centre has been a crucial first point ofresponse for such emergencies. The personnel deployed at the Communication Centre have played a critical role in such emergencies, however,the remuneration have not seen corresponding increases due to the lack of fee revisions over l.he years. 4. Despite the yearly increase in expenses for manning, upkeep, and maintenance of the Communication Centre, driven by the risingConsumer Price Index (CPI), the fee structure to cover these expenses has not been revised since 2010. 5. After careful review and analysis of the subject matter, a decision has been taken to revise the one-time registration fees and the annual fee for the services provided by the DG Communication Centre to meet the increasing expenses. Fee demand of DG Communication Centre will be raised to the port (major /non- major) and shipyards by DG Communication Centre of DG Shipping in the form of Statement of Contribution for one time registration and annual fees. Further, auditors undertaking verification audits of Major and Non major ports and Indian Ships shall verify that dues forthe DGCOMM Centre are paid by the Port authorities and ship owner prior to conduct of ISPS audits. 10. In the event the applicable fees due are not cleared by the stipulated date, appropriate action as deemed necessary and additional penalty shall be imposed by the Directorate. t l. Further. the fees payable will be checked by DGCOMM center during annual testing of Ship Security Alert System (SSAS) any by the Mercantile Marine Departments. 12. It is to be noted that the fund collected for operation of DG Comm Centre is of the stakeholders and it is not the revenue of IRS or DGS. DC Comm Centre operates based on cost sharing arrangement among the stakeholders which is evident from DGS circulars on this matter. Since the contribution by the stake holders is their share of operation ofthe DG Comm Centre and it is based on the concept of mutuality, the applicability of TDS Deduction, GST lely etc. may not arise as there is no commercial service provided. 13.
